전담 개발자를 고용할 때 피해야 할 실수
게시 됨: 2022-09-29프로젝트를 위해 개발자를 고용할 때 실수를 피하기 위해 가능한 모든 일을 하고 있는지 확인하는 것이 중요합니다. 이 블로그는 사람들이 저지르는 가장 흔한 채용 실수와 이를 피하는 방법에 대해 설명합니다. 피해야 할 함정을 알면 많은 시간과 문제를 절약할 수 있습니다.
프로젝트 개발 작업을 아웃소싱하면 여러 가지 이점이 있습니다. 숙련된 개발자가 팀에 있으면 핵심 비즈니스 활동과 같은 더 중요한 일에 집중할 수 있습니다. 화이트 라벨 아웃소싱은 계획한 프로젝트의 개발을 완료할 전문 지식이나 리소스가 없는 소규모 회사와 신생 기업에서 흔히 볼 수 있는 관행입니다. 처음부터 프로젝트를 빌드하는 방법을 정확히 알고 있는 경험 있고 유연한 풀 스택 개발자 팀을 보유하는 데 도움이 됩니다. 결국 아웃소싱은 프로젝트가 시장에 도달하는 데 걸리는 시간을 단축하는 데 도움이 될 수도 있습니다.
피해야 할 실수
프로젝트에 적합한 개발자를 고용하는 것은 어려운 작업일 수 있지만 약간의 연구와 전략을 사용하면 프로세스가 훨씬 더 원활해질 수 있습니다. 개발자를 고용할 때 피해야 할 6가지 실수는 다음과 같습니다.
1. 조사 없이 회사 선택하기
적절한 조사를 하지 않고 개발자를 선택하면 좌절과 불만족으로 이어질 수 있습니다. 귀하의 요구 사항이 무엇인지 명확히 하십시오. 예를 들어, 저렴한 제안에 속지 마십시오. 또한, 가입 또는 계약하기 전에 회사의 실적과 평판을 확인하십시오. 웹사이트, 소셜 미디어 페이지(Facebook, Twitter, LinkedIn 등)에서 또는 Clutch 또는 GoodFirms와 같은 인기 있는 비즈니스 디렉토리에 대한 고객 리뷰를 통해 정보를 찾을 수도 있습니다. 그들이 얼마나 오랫동안 사업을 했는지, 얼마나 많은 프로젝트를 수행했는지, 그들이 능숙한 기술 스택에 주의를 기울이십시오. 이렇게 하면 그들이 특정 프로젝트에 필요한 경험을 가지고 있는지 알 수 있습니다.
2. 지리적으로 자신을 제한하기
적합한 기술 인력을 찾는 데 있어 지리적 경계에 제한을 두지 마십시오. 대신, 더 넓은 관점을 가지고 필요한 경우 전 세계에서 개발자를 고용하는 것을 고려하십시오. 이렇게 하면 평균보다 저렴한 가격으로 우수한 품질의 작업을 얻을 수 있습니다. 예를 들어 프로젝트를 인도 개발자에게 아웃소싱하면 뛰어난 작업을 얻을 수 있지만 상당히 저렴한 가격에 얻을 수 있습니다.
물론 개발자와 지속적으로 소통해야 한다는 점을 명심하는 것도 매우 중요합니다. 따라서 팀을 선택할 때 언어 장벽을 염두에 두어야 합니다. 당신이 서로를 이해할 수 없다면 바다 건너 값싼 개발자를 찾는 것은 아무 의미가 없습니다.
3. 가치보다 가격을 우선시
개발자를 선택할 때 가격이 항상 가장 중요한 요소는 아닙니다. 물론 예산 관리도 필요하지만 가격보다 실력과 경험을 우선시해야 합니다. 이렇게 하면 개발자가 귀하의 돈을 위해 큰 가치를 제공할 수 있다는 것을 확신할 수 있습니다. 단순히 그렇게 하기 위해 더 낮은 요금을 기꺼이 제공하려는 개발자보다 숙련되고 경험이 풍부한 개발자를 항상 선호해야 합니다.
부자연스럽게 낮은 가격을 제공하는 개발자는 일반적으로 필요한 기술과 경험이 부족하여 정밀 조사를 견디지 못하거나 아예 실패할 수도 있는 열등한 앱이 될 수 있습니다. 사실, 경험이 부족한 팀을 구하는 것은 수리하거나 수정하는 데 더 많은 시간과 노력이 필요한 실수가 발생하기 때문에 종종 더 많은 비용이 듭니다. 반면에 전담 팀은 장기적으로 더 많은 돈을 벌 수 있는 고품질 제품으로 더 높은 개발 비용을 상쇄할 수 있습니다.
4. 부당한 시한을 부과하는 행위
부당하게 짧은 기한을 설정하는 것은 결코 좋은 생각이 아닙니다. 제품이 지연될 뿐만 아니라 품질에도 부정적인 영향을 미칠 수 있습니다. 또한, 촉박한 마감 시간으로 헌신적인 팀을 서두르는 것은 단기적으로 불만과 긴장을 유발할 뿐입니다. 이 전략을 시도하는 대신 팀 구성원이 작업을 효율적이고 높은 수준으로 완료할 수 있는 충분한 시간을 허용하는 더 긴 타임라인을 사용하는 것이 좋습니다.
팀을 위한 최적의 업계 표준 작업 일정은 주당 40시간 또는 하루 8시간 정도입니다. 불합리한 마감일을 설정하면 팀이 초과 근무를 해야 할 수 있으며 이는 프로젝트에 좋지 않습니다. 연구에 따르면 주당 60시간 정도 일하는 팀은 넷째 주(Existek)부터 생산성이 급격히 떨어지는 것으로 나타났습니다.
5. 개발자를 인터뷰하지 않음
소프트웨어 개발자를 고용할 때 올바른 접근 방식은 면밀한 프로세스를 갖는 것입니다. 적합한 인재를 선별하고 있는지 확인하고 처음 만나는 개발자만 데려가지 마십시오. 의심스러운 경우 여러 회사를 살펴보십시오. 위험 신호를 조기에 감지할 수 있도록 사전에 적절한 질문을 준비하는 것도 중요합니다. 예를 들어 Magento 개발자를 고용하려는 경우 이전 전자 상거래 개발 경험과 최신 버전에서 제공하는 특정 기능에 대해 질문해야 합니다. 어려운 질문을 하는 것을 두려워하지 마십시오. 이렇게 하면 개발 프로세스 전반에 걸쳐 양 당사자 간의 신뢰를 구축하고 더 나은 의사 소통을 달성하는 데 도움이 됩니다.
6. NDA 및 개인 정보 보호 정책 무시
데이터 – 대부분의 비즈니스와 프로젝트는 방대한 양의 데이터에서 실행됩니다. 그리고 인공 지능이 발전하고 비즈니스에 통합되면서 민감한 정보가 훨씬 더 위험에 처해 있습니다. 그렇기 때문에 기밀 데이터를 보호하기 위해 회사의 NDA(비공개 계약) 및 개인 정보 보호 정책을 숙지해야 합니다.
개발자는 매일 기밀 데이터로 작업합니다. 따라서 관련된 모든 당사자가 NDA 및 개인 정보 보호 정책 조건을 엄격하게 준수하도록 하는 것은 귀하의 비즈니스 이익을 보호하는 데 필수적입니다. 다시 한 번 구두 보증으로는 충분하지 않습니다. 이것이 효과적이기 위해서는 법적으로 문서화되어야 합니다. 그런 다음에야 이러한 약속에 기반한 조치를 취하는 데 대한 고려가 이루어져야 합니다.
결론
프로젝트에 적합한 개발자를 찾는 데 있어 철저하고 조사를 수행해야 합니다. 잘못된 개발자를 고용하면 비즈니스에 심각한 결과를 초래할 수 있으므로 이러한 일반적인 실수를 피하는 것이 중요합니다. 후보자를 철저히 조사함으로써 프로젝트에 잘못된 개발자를 고용할 위험을 줄일 수 있습니다.